Transaction 1c2711d60dcd41f89c341009e10107b3d8ff3db6d092082c3d25baee9067fda2

2 Input
1 Outputs
  • 1c2711d60dcd41f89c341009e10107b3d8ff3db6d092082c3d25baee9067fda2:0
  • value  2597915
    address  33HfKFuJnZ1xyrgEA8ke7oc99PfJPSHi5e